通讯小程序的故障排查与优化有哪些方法?

随着移动互联网的快速发展,通讯小程序已经成为人们日常生活中不可或缺的一部分。然而,在使用过程中,通讯小程序难免会出现故障。为了确保用户能够正常使用,提高用户体验,对通讯小程序进行故障排查与优化显得尤为重要。本文将从以下几个方面介绍通讯小程序的故障排查与优化方法。

一、故障排查方法

  1. 用户反馈

用户在使用过程中遇到的问题,是故障排查的重要线索。通过收集用户反馈,可以快速定位故障原因。具体方法如下:

(1)建立用户反馈渠道,如客服电话、在线客服、论坛等;

(2)对用户反馈的问题进行分类整理,便于后续排查;

(3)对常见问题进行汇总,形成常见问题解答(FAQ)。


  1. 日志分析

通讯小程序在运行过程中会产生大量日志,通过对日志进行分析,可以找到故障发生的线索。具体方法如下:

(1)收集小程序的运行日志;

(2)使用日志分析工具,对日志进行筛选、排序、统计等操作;

(3)根据日志信息,定位故障发生的时间、地点、原因等。


  1. 网络监控

网络是通讯小程序运行的基础,对网络进行监控,可以及时发现网络问题。具体方法如下:

(1)使用网络监控工具,实时监测网络状态;

(2)分析网络流量、延迟、丢包等指标,找出网络瓶颈;

(3)针对网络问题,调整网络配置或优化网络架构。


  1. 硬件设备检查

硬件设备故障也可能导致通讯小程序出现故障。对硬件设备进行检查,可以排除硬件问题。具体方法如下:

(1)检查服务器、网络设备等硬件设备运行状态;

(2)对硬件设备进行升级或更换,确保其正常运行;

(3)对硬件设备进行定期维护,预防故障发生。

二、优化方法

  1. 代码优化

(1)优化算法,提高代码执行效率;

(2)减少代码冗余,提高代码可读性;

(3)使用缓存技术,提高数据访问速度。


  1. 网络优化

(1)优化网络请求,减少数据传输量;

(2)使用CDN加速,提高页面加载速度;

(3)优化DNS解析,减少域名解析时间。


  1. 界面优化

(1)优化界面布局,提高用户体验;

(2)使用图片压缩技术,减少图片大小;

(3)优化动画效果,提高页面流畅度。


  1. 数据库优化

(1)优化数据库索引,提高查询效率;

(2)使用数据库分片技术,提高数据存储能力;

(3)定期清理数据库,防止数据冗余。


  1. 安全优化

(1)加强身份验证,防止恶意攻击;

(2)加密敏感数据,保护用户隐私;

(3)定期更新安全策略,防范安全风险。

总结

通讯小程序的故障排查与优化是保证小程序稳定运行、提高用户体验的关键。通过对故障排查方法的掌握和优化方法的运用,可以有效解决通讯小程序的故障,提高小程序的整体性能。在实际工作中,应根据具体情况,灵活运用各种方法,确保通讯小程序的稳定运行。

猜你喜欢:IM服务